How to get from Thomas-Chapais / Ernest-Chouinard to Stade Canac by bus?

From Thomas-Chapais / Ernest-Chouinard to Stade Canac by bus

To get from Thomas-Chapais / Ernest-Chouinard to Stade Canac in Québec,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 13 bus from Thomas-Chapais / Ernest-Chouinard station to Station Des Rubis station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the L2 bus and finally take the 801 bus from Germain-Des-Prés station to Pte-Lièvres/6644 station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 28 min.
